The specific classes of viewpoint are as follows: Catalogs are specific foundational viewpoints that represent lists of building blocks. Matrices are specific foundational viewpoints that show the relationships between building blocks of specific types. Diagrams are graphical … github leshan https://bioforcene.com

WebbTOGAF defines three distinct artifact classes: Catalogs are lists of building blocks. Matrices show the relationships between building blocks of specific types.
